Fitch Street Public School in Welland is expanding, thanks to $15.4-milllion from the Ontario government.
The money will help create 205 more spaces, and 49 licenced child care spaces.
The government says the work is part of a $1.3-billion investment to support new school construction and expand existing ones.
Sue Barnett is the Chair of the DSBN, and says Welland is a flourishing city, and proud home to thousands of outstanding students.
